Cure: The Virus of Evil

Introduction What if evil wasn’t a conscious choice, a deliberate act of malevolence, but an insidious contagion, a psychological virus transmitted through suggestion? Kiyoshi Kurosawa’s Cure (1997) poses this chilling question, weaving a narrative that is both deeply unsettling and profoundly thought-provoking.
